SUMMARY;LANGUAGE=en-us:"Building New Traditions: St. Patrick's Day, Brú Na Bóinne, and Spurlock"
DESCRIPTION:"\rOn St. Patrick’s Day, many people in America think of “Irish” imagery such as shamrocks, beer, and pots of gold at the end of rainbows. But Ireland has a rich and wondrous history, some of which has only recently been—or still remains to be—unearthed. Join the Spurlock staff as we discover the many treasures of the The Boyne Valley (including the Passage Tombs of Knowth (external link), Newgrange (external link), and Dowth (external link)); consider why humans build rock formations; decorate rocks; and craft a rock formation on the museum grounds. \r\rNOTE: Please bring a clean stone of your choosing to paint or decorate. If you would like to take it home with you, please bring TWO stones to decorate, and leave one with us!\r\rImage: Newgrange Stone Age Passage Tomb - Boyne Valley, Ireland, by John5199 (external link), CC BY 2.0 \r\r"
